Handwriting practice is crucial for children ages 6-8 as it sets the foundation for essential literacy and motor skills. At this developmental stage, children’s f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ination need strengthening, which consistent handwriting practice effectively provides. Neatly writing letters and words not only improves their legibility but boosts cognitive development. When children carefully form letters, they reinforce letter recognition and phonics, pivotal for reading progression.
Teachers and parents should value easy handwriting practice because it promotes patience and attention to detail. It also contributes to a child’s confidence and ability to communicate. Good handwriting facilitates better academic performance as it enables clear note-taking and eases the process of organizing thoughts in written form. Furthermore, the act of writing by hand stimulates brain development differently than typing, enhancing memory retention and understanding.
Another fundamental reason is that strong handwriting skills prepare children for future learning demands and standardized tests, where legibly written answers can sometimes impact scoring. Thus, providing a stress-free environment and appropriate tools for handwriting practice ensures children build these critical skills joyfully and effectively, fostering a positive relationship with writing and overall learning.
